Reasons Why Your Business Needs a Flutter Mobile App in 2024
In the digital age, having a mobile app for your business is no longer just an option—it’s a necessity. As technology continues to advance, Flutter, Google’s open-source UI software development toolkit, has emerged as a powerful choice for businesses looking to develop mobile applications. Here are several compelling reasons why your business should consider a Flutter mobile app in 2024.
People Also Like to Read: The Significance of CI/CD in Software Development
Why does Business Consider Flutter Mobile App in 2024?
1. Cost-Efficient Development
One of the primary advantages of Flutter is its ability to streamline the development process and reduce costs. Unlike traditional app development, which often requires separate codebases for iOS and Android, Flutter allows you to write a single codebase that works across both platforms. This not only speeds up development but also lowers the overall cost since you don’t need separate teams for each platform.
2. Faster Time to Market
In today’s competitive market, speed is crucial. Flutter’s hot reload feature allows developers to see changes in real time without restarting the app. This capability significantly accelerates the development process, enabling quicker iterations and faster delivery of updates and new features. By reducing the time to market, your business can respond to market demands more swiftly and gain a competitive edge.
3. Consistent User Experience
Flutter provides a unified framework for creating apps that deliver a consistent user experience across multiple platforms. With Flutter, you can ensure that your app looks and feels the same on both iOS and Android devices, providing a seamless and cohesive experience for users. This consistency helps build brand recognition and trust, which is crucial for user retention and satisfaction.
4. High Performance
Flutter apps are compiled into native ARM code, which results in high performance and smooth user interactions. The framework eliminates the need for a JavaScript bridge, reducing performance bottlenecks that can occur in other cross-platform frameworks. For businesses that require high-performance applications, such as those with complex animations or real-time functionalities, Flutter’s performance benefits are a significant advantage.
5. Rich and Customizable UI
With Flutter, you gain access to a rich set of pre-designed widgets and tools that adhere to Material Design and Cupertino (iOS-style) guidelines. These widgets are highly customizable, allowing you to create unique and engaging user interfaces tailored to your brand’s identity. Whether you need intricate animations or a specific look and feel, Flutter’s extensive UI capabilities enable you to design an app that stands out in the crowded app marketplace.
6. Growing Ecosystem
Flutter’s ecosystem is continually expanding, with a robust selection of packages and plugins available to extend its functionality. These include libraries for state management, network operations, and integration with various services. The growing ecosystem means that you can leverage existing solutions to add complex features to your app without starting from scratch, saving development time and resources.
7. Strong Community Support
The Flutter community is active and vibrant, providing a wealth of resources, including tutorials, forums, and open-source projects. This strong community support is invaluable for troubleshooting issues, gaining insights, and staying updated with the latest developments. For businesses, having access to a supportive community can facilitate smoother development processes and quicker problem resolution.
8. Future-Proof Technology
Flutter is continuously evolving, with regular updates and improvements from Google. As a modern framework, Flutter is designed to adapt to new technologies and trends, ensuring that your app remains relevant and up-to-date. By choosing Flutter, you invest in a future-proof technology that can grow with your business and adapt to emerging market demands.
9. Integration with Google Services
Flutter integrates seamlessly with various Google services, including Firebase, Google’s mobile and web application development platform. This integration provides access to a range of backend services, such as real-time databases, authentication, and analytics. By leveraging these services, you can enhance your app’s functionality and streamline backend development, making it easier to build and scale your app.
10. Enhanced Maintenance and Updates
Maintaining and updating an app can be a cumbersome task, especially if it involves multiple codebases. Flutter’s single codebase approach simplifies maintenance and updates, as changes can be applied across both iOS and Android platforms simultaneously. This streamlined maintenance process reduces the risk of inconsistencies and bugs, ensuring that your app remains functional and up-to-date with minimal effort.
You Might Also Like To Read: The Ultimate Guide to Educational App Development Services
Conclusion
In 2024, Flutter offers a compelling array of benefits for businesses looking to develop mobile applications. From cost-efficient development and faster time to market to high performance and a rich user experience, Flutter provides the tools and features needed to create exceptional apps. Its growing ecosystem, strong community support, and seamless integration with Google services further enhance its value. By choosing Flutter for your mobile app development, you position your business to thrive in a competitive digital landscape and deliver a top-notch experience to your users.
Jabit Soft is a leading provider of comprehensive IT and development services, dedicated to empowering businesses through cutting-edge software development and digital solutions. With a global presence, we have completed 1500+ projects including some government projects that drive growth and innovation for your organization.